Welcome to episode 25 of Paths in the Outdoors, we speak to Harrison Ward who found the outdoors after a difficult few years and incorporated his love of food combining his new and old passions. He uses his experiences to share with other, bringing people around the ‘table’ with the food he cooks on the fells. This path has led to all kinds of opportunities, one of the highlights being on the BBC with Mary Berry. As a mental health advocate he tells his story for others to see the benefits of the outdoors and finding a passion.
